Benchmark analyst Nathan Martin raised the firm’s price target on Ramaco Resources (METC) to $24 from $14 and keeps a Buy rating on the shares. Q2 adjusted EBITDA of $9M fell short of the $12M consensus and the firm’s $13M estimate, but the firm continues to believe Ramaco will “prudently wait for offtake agreements before green-lighting commercial production,” the analyst tells investors in a post-earnings note.
